I had just cut back our 4 first year "Dark Night" to about 2' or so, sat down at my computer, and here was your new video :) They say here in Zone 8B in NC Dark Night can get as big as yours but if you don't cut it back hard it will only bloom at the top. It looks to me like the BEAUTIFUL structure of yours after cutting back is the result of a few or more years, I don't really know, of well thought out pruning. Yours is inspiring. May I ask what you feed yours with to get things kicked off?
I will give my butterfly bush Espoma food and will cover it with compost. Butterfly bush has shallow roots. Last year I added a small amount of blood meal and saw good results.

Amazing. I am planting my first butterfly bush this year. Do you trim your bush down to this height each year? It does look quite drastic.
Yes, I do, that is an old bush and it puts a lot of growth every year. Next time I do a video around that part, you would be able to see how quickly it is putting on a canopy. If you want your butterfly bush to be wide and bushy, do trim it in spring.
I live in zone 5 and probably get some snow. I’m worried about my butterfly bush might brake by the weight of snow. Should I prune now, November 12, 2022?
Sure, prune your butterfly bush. Those shrubs are very forgiving. I take half of mine every year.
